 In three years, Mac Melto went from not making the Varsity Finals in the 400m run to Chicago Public League Champion! 

 In 2009 (Freshman Year), Mac Melto placed third in the Sophomore Chicago Public League Championships with a time of 52.47.

 In 2010, (Sophomore Year), Mac Melto did not make the Varsity Finals in the 400m run.

 In 2011, (Junior Year), Mac Melto qualified for the Varsity Finals with an outstanding time of 49.88!  

 On Saturday, May 7, 2011, in the 400m run, Northside Junior Mac Melto BROKE THE SCHOOL RECORD AND WON THE CITY TITLE with a personal best time of 49.30. Mac Melto was awarded a Medal for winning the City Title in the 400m run! Mac Melto will be honored in practice on Monday with a Watermelon for breaking the school record!

 In the 1600m run, Northside Junior Ezra Edgerton DROPPED 3 SECONDS to place seventh overall with a personal best time of 4:41.58. Ezra Edgerton earned All City Honors and was awarded a Medal for placing seventh overall. Ezra Edgerton ran the first 400m in 68 seconds, and then ran the next 400m in 73 seconds (2:21 800m), and then ran the next 400m in a NEGATIVE SPLIT of 70 seconds (3:31 1200m), and then ran the final 400m in an EVEN SPLIT of 70 seconds for a personal best time of 4:41.58. Ezra Edgerton passed Alumni legend Cooper Eben on the 1600m All Time list! imageimageimage
